Palais Drechsler, Renaissance Revival palace in Budapest District VI, Hungary
Palais Drechsler occupies a three-story building at 25 Andrássy Avenue with four facades displaying French Renaissance Revival architectural elements. The symmetrical composition and refined decorative details shape the appearance of this notable structure along one of the city's most prestigious avenues.
Architects Ödön Lechner and Gyula Pártos designed the building between 1883 and 1886 for the Hungarian State Railways Pension Institute. The structure reflects the architectural developments of that period in the city's urban landscape.
It housed the State Ballet Institute from 1949 to 2002, shaping generations of Hungarian dancers and their training. The building still carries the legacy of being a center for dance education and artistic development in the city.
The palace sits directly opposite the State Opera House and is easily reached via the Opera station on metro line 1. Its central location on Andrássy Avenue makes it a convenient stop while exploring the district.
The interior features two grand staircases with a double-entrance design and decorated stained glass windows that illuminate the interior spaces. Vaulted sections in the basement level contain architectural details that visitors often overlook.
